More often than not the daemon primarchs have petty squabbles amongst themselves. Best example of this is the war between the Emperor's Children and the World Eaters during which Khârn went on a bloody rampage and successfully annihilated his own legion and reduced it to scattered warbands.

 

Basically the daemon primarchs have all but left their legions (or what's left of them) to their own devices. The commanders of these legions and war amongst themselves and so very rarely organize themselves into a coherant fighting force that can prosecute their ancient war against the Imperium.

 

Of course Abaddon is one of the only ones to successfully rally the traitor legions into a unified army. But as for the primarchs, they really don't give much of a **** anymore.

The most notable actions Angron took after the Horus Heresy :

 

- The Battle of Skalathrax. War against the Emperor's Children. He lost the control of his Legion at this time after Khârn’s treachery (only 1 company called the Angron's Chosen, is still under his direct orders ).

 

- The Dominion of Fire (M38). Angron and 50’000 Berzerkers of Khorne (not all are World Eaters I think) slaughtered 20 Imperial sectors for over 2 centuries.

 

- The First War for Armageddon (M40). Angron and 4 World Eaters companies (4'000 Berzerkers?) attack Armageddon. Angron is banned to the Warp for 1 century.

 

- Now : Angron is reincarnated, ready to kick ass again.

From what I can remember, Mortarion is effectively a slave-driver on his Plague planet and most of the Death Guard live there. However, Typhus and a few renegades (the irony) left the planet and continue spreading Nurgle's afflictions; hence why Typhus the traveller is so called.

If I remember correctly Typhus left to become the traveller because Mort created the Plague Planet in the image of Barbarus. Other than that Mort is creating plagues and sending his underlings and their followers out into the universe to spead Nurgles Blessings.

Magnus on the other hand is sending his sorcerors out on obscure missions to further his own goals.

Angron is busy unbanishing himself and Fulgrim is trapped in a painting (lets not talk about what the Daemon is doing :P )

Peurturabo (sp?) Lorgar, Alpharus and Omegon are all pulling the strings of their Legions.
